Is Mitt Romney making a comeback? Polls aren’t showing one yet but a solid debate performance will be the ultimate test in order to see if the presidential race is over or whether we are back to a horse race.
It’s important to remember though that presidential debates don’t normally impact the outcome of the election.Remember, John Kerry beat President George W. Bush handily in the debates in 2004.
It’s all about the electoral college. The first candidate to 270 wins and it remains to be seen how any stellar debate performance for Mitt Romney can help him out with this math.
